Transaction e73b649700f3644e76d5869d6b39faddceb21afe3ffca0f2585494c324996d28
2 Input
2 Outputs
- e73b649700f3644e76d5869d6b39faddceb21afe3ffca0f2585494c324996d28:0
- e73b649700f3644e76d5869d6b39faddceb21afe3ffca0f2585494c324996d28:1
value 1329790
address 36qsC7xAnVoeHQmY1Brat1qVT1Dxjektea
value 12087449
address 1HVe2Rf3MkynWsPvCCwwVc8546s6Y55hn4